Show that the set is linearly dependent by finding a nontrivial linear combination of vectors in the set whose sum is the zero vector. (Use 𝑠1, 𝑠2, and 𝑠3, respectively, for the vectors in the set.)
𝑆={(5,4),(-1,1),(2,0)}
(0,0)=
Express the vector 𝑠1 in the set as a linear combination of the vectors 𝑠2 and 𝑠3.
𝑠1=4𝑠2+92𝑠3
